nOw for the second one!!!!!! It is in the left from frame cross member! There is a hole behind the sway bar that you can see down in. There is another hole to the same passage on the opisite side of the crossmember. Then inside the engine bay...behind the steering shaft down low there is another hole to the same passage. I had the best luck with a coat hanger that was "strategically" bent...and LOTS OF PATIENCE!!
I got about 95% of that one! It was harder to get to and was more dirty but it was all there and NOT GLUED IN!!!!
